EVS/MVS is a customizable 3D analysis and visualization software. ○EVS-Standard The most basic EVS-Standard includes customizable modules for geological and environmental use. For example, it features 3D model construction capabilities using differential or automatic mesh division, 3D panel diagrams, simultaneous data analysis for multiple types, and functions for creating cross-sections and cut models. In addition to these features, it has pre-data creation and post-3D modeling capabilities for standard fluid analysis programs such as MODFLOW, MT3D, and CFEST.

We support the visualization of 3D data in all fields related to Earth sciences. 【Features】 ○MVS The Mining Visualization System (MVS) is C Tech's premier modeling software. MVS was developed in response to the demands of mining exploration technology. This technology is also utilized in civil geology and advanced environmental analysis. MVS adds features targeted at fields requiring advanced expertise, in addition to the functions of EVS-PRO, meeting the diverse needs of exploration technicians, mining development planners, civil geology technicians, geologists, and environmental scientists. ○EVS-Pro EVS-PRO is the most popular software for spatial analysis, 3D visualization, and animation. Our main product is consulting engineers. Their characteristic is that, based on the fundamentals of natural sciences (geology and geotechnical engineering), engineers who are licensed professionals directly collect information through field surveys, allowing for a high-level understanding of the natural conditions that "no two locations have the same ground or topographical conditions." This enables the appropriate extraction of important items that need to be evaluated on-site, leading to rational problem-solving. Unlike standardized ground modeling and analysis methods based on guidelines and manuals, we uncover core issues and phenomena not covered by standard methods, allowing us to propose highly effective countermeasures while also enabling the development of new analysis methods and construction techniques. For example, three-dimensional stability analysis considering peripheral strength (Ota-Hayashi method), seismic analysis of fill embankments in valleys (Ota-Enokida model), and slope stability countermeasures effectively utilizing the strength within soil masses (disruption method) have emerged from this background.
